LOANS TO JUDICIAL CAMPAIGNS RANGE UP TO $73,000


There are five contested Caddo judicial races with 14 candidates on the Nov. 3 primary.

The judicial districts are geographic areas. Thus not all five contested elections will be on each ballot.

Six candidates have loaned substantial sums to their campaigns.

This list is based on the last campaign filing report date of Oct. 14.

Candidate loans:

Paul Wood--candidate for Shreveport City Court--$73,000

Edward Mouton--candidate for Shreveport City Court--$58,700

Chris Victory--candidate for Caddo District Court--$30,000

Mary Winchell–candidate for Caddo District Court– $17,000

Emily Merckle–candidate for Shreveport City Court--$7,500

Trina Chu–candidate for Second Circuit Court of Appeals--$3,200

Undoubtedly several candidates will loan their campaign more money for the 19 days after the last report to cover expenses through Nov. 3.
